THE goal for some of the Premier League clubs this season is simple – win a trophy.

Last season Manchester City, Manchester United and West Ham managed it.

But for other top-flight sides, lifting silverware is a distant memory.

So, with that in mind, SunSport gives you a guide to what was going on in the world the last time each Prem club won a meaningful trophy (we might have used a bit of artistic licence…).

Here’s what was hot when they last won a pot…

ARSENAL (FA CUP, 2020)

Only one story in town in 2020 and it wasn’t the Gunners beating Chelsea in the Cup final.

Covid meant the showpiece was played behind closed doors.

ASTON VILLA (LEAGUE CUP, 1996)

Andy Townsend didn’t exactly go to infinity and beyond like Buzz and Woody in the first Toy Story . . . but he did go to Wembley and lift a trophy for Villa.

BOURNEMOUTH (CHAMPIONSHIP, 2015)

The Cherries are still going strong eight years on from winning the Championship — unlike the first Love Island winners Jessica and Max who split up after six weeks.

BRENTFORD (LONDON WAR CUP, 1942)

Yes, the Bees have won a few EFL titles since but lifting the London War Cup in the year Casablanca came out is far more romantic than a play-off pot.

BRIGHTON (CHARITY SHIELD, 2010)

They’ve won the third and fourth tiers but Albion’s only major trophy remains the Charity Shield in 1910, when Walnut Whips made their debut and moustaches were all the rage.

BURNLEY (FIRST DIVISION, 1960)

When Burnley were champions of England, The Beatles were just starting, Elvis was in the building and Fred Flintstone was giving it the full Yabba Dabba Doo.

CHELSEA (CHAMPIONS LEAGUE, 2021)

European glory came at the same time as Squid Game, a TV show that featured 456 contestants — much the same as Chelsea’s first-team squad.

CRYSTAL PALACE (DIVISION ONE, 1994)

While the Gallagher brothers were releasing Definitely Maybe, Gareth Southgate was going Supersonic as Palace’s promotion-winning captain.

EVERTON (FA CUP, 1995)

The year that saw the original PlayStation make its bow and Paul Rideout win the Cup for the Toffees. One went on to be a global phenomenon, the other was Paul Rideout.

FULHAM (INTERTOTO CUP, 2002)

Championship kings in 2022 but Fulham’s Intertoto Cup in 2002 just about trumps that — a competition that made even less sense than Tony Blackburn winning the first I’m A Celeb.

LIVERPOOL (FA CUP, 2022)

Ironic that Liverpool were last in their prime the same year YouTubers KSI and Logan Paul were launching Prime. Now they need a refresh.

LUTON (LEAGUE CUP, 1988)

Luton’s chances of Prem survival are probably slimmer than John McClane’s when he popped into the Nakatomi Plaza. But 1988 was a good year for both.

MAN CITY (CHAMPIONS LEAGUE, 2023)

You don’t need a good memory to recall this, although Jack Grealish may be a little hazy on events. His three-day bender earned him legendary status.

MAN UTD (LEAGUE CUP, 2023)

United ended a six-year wait for a trophy in the same month Rihanna chose the tranquil setting of a half-time Super Bowl show to announce her pregnancy.

NEWCASTLE (FAIRS CUP, 1969)

Forget the Div Two titles, any true Geordie will tell you the Fairs Cup was Toon’s last pot. Neil Armstrong landed on the Moon and the Space Hopper was born.

NOTTM FOREST (LEAGUE CUP, 1990)

When Forest beat Oldham, MC Hammer was heading for stardom. It’s fairly safe to assume Brian Clough wouldn’t have been a fan of his trousers.

SHEFFIELD UNITED (FA CUP, 1925)

A few EFL titles aside, the Blades’ last major trophy came almost a century ago when the flappers were on the dance floor, not between the sticks.

TOTTENHAM (LEAGUE CUP, 2008)

Will Smith’s star was firmly in the ascendancy when Spurs lifted the League Cup. Now it’s a different story. Even Tottenham might win something before him.

WEST HAM (EUROPA CONF LEAGUE, 2023)

Jarrod Bowen’s heroics led to fans serenading him with their infamous song about Dani Dyer. Even her dad Danny called it a bit of romance.

WOLVES (LEAGUE CUP, 1980)

Not sure what was more shocking when Wolves last won a major pot — them beating Forest or Darth Vader revealing he was Luke’s father in The Empire Strikes Back.
